  • Part 3 of our How it's Made Series on TeamConnect Ceiling Solutions reveals how our KE 10 electret capsules are charged. The electret component allows each capsule to run at a much lower voltage than a standard condenser microphone, delivering maximum sound, from minimal energy usage. Once the electret is charged and tested, it's placed into a capsule housing, and sent off for Stage 4: PCB and final assembly.
